Social Work Coordinator Jobs in Warwick, RI
A Social Work Coordinator in the social service industry orchestrates and oversees the provision of social services to individuals, families, and communities, often serving as the link between clients and service providers. They handle the planning, development, and implementation of social service programs, ensuring that they meet the needs of the target population. Their duties include program coordination, crisis intervention, resource allocation, and case management. The Social Work Coordinator also develops and maintains partnerships with other service institutions or agencies to enhance service delivery.
Essential skills for this role include strong interpersonal and communication skills, problem-solving, empathy, and resilience. They should also possess excellent organizational and leadership abilities. A Social Work Coordinator must be certified, often requiring a Master's degree in Social Work (MSW), and licensure which varies by state. Prior to becoming a Social Work Coordinator, an individual might work as a Social Worker, Case Manager, or Family Support Worker, gaining experience in providing direct services, assessing client needs, and coordinating community resources.
